零件编程需要什么技术

fiy 其他 36

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    零件编程是指利用计算机软件进行零件设计和加工的过程。在进行零件编程时,需要掌握以下几项技术:

    1. CAD软件:CAD(计算机辅助设计)软件是进行零件设计的基础工具。掌握一种或多种常用的CAD软件,如AutoCAD、SolidWorks、CATIA等,能够帮助设计师进行零件的三维建模、尺寸标注、装配设计等操作。

    2. CAM软件:CAM(计算机辅助制造)软件是进行零件加工的关键工具。通过CAM软件,可以将零件设计文件转化为加工指令,控制数控机床进行切削、钻孔、铣削等加工操作。常用的CAM软件有Mastercam、PowerMill、EdgeCAM等。

    3. 编程语言:在进行零件编程时,需要掌握一种或多种编程语言,如G代码、M代码等。G代码是数控机床的控制语言,用于描述刀具的运动轨迹和切削参数;M代码是数控机床的功能指令,用于控制辅助设备的运行。了解和掌握这些编程语言,能够编写正确的加工程序,实现零件的精确加工。

    4. 数控机床操作:零件编程涉及到数控机床的操作,因此需要了解数控机床的结构和工作原理,熟悉数控机床的操作界面和功能键的使用方法。同时,还需要掌握数控机床的安全操作规程,确保在编程和加工过程中不发生意外。

    5. 材料知识:在进行零件编程时,需要了解所使用材料的特性和加工要求。不同材料的切削参数和切削工具的选择都会对加工结果产生影响。因此,掌握材料知识,能够根据零件的要求选择合适的切削参数和刀具,提高加工效率和质量。

    综上所述,零件编程需要掌握CAD软件、CAM软件、编程语言、数控机床操作和材料知识等技术。只有全面掌握这些技术,才能够进行高效、精确的零件设计和加工。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    零件编程是一种将物理零件与计算机编程相结合的技术。它主要用于创建交互式的物理装置,如机器人、无人机、传感器等。要进行零件编程,需要掌握以下几个技术:

    1. 电子硬件知识:了解电子元件的种类、功能和工作原理是进行零件编程的基础。掌握如何使用电路板、传感器、执行器等组件,并了解它们如何与计算机进行通信。

    2. 嵌入式系统开发:零件编程通常涉及嵌入式系统,这是一种专门用于控制和管理硬件设备的计算机系统。学习嵌入式系统开发包括掌握嵌入式编程语言(如C、C++)、硬件驱动程序开发和实时操作系统等。

    3. 物理计算:零件编程需要将计算机的逻辑与物理世界相结合。学习物理计算包括使用传感器读取物理量(如温度、光强等)、分析传感器数据、控制执行器(如电机、舵机等)以及编写算法来处理和响应物理信号。

    4. 机器人学:如果你想编程控制机器人,那么了解机器人学是必不可少的。机器人学涉及到机器人的运动规划、传感器融合、物体识别等方面的知识,这些都是零件编程中常见的任务。

    5. 编程语言:在零件编程中,常用的编程语言包括Arduino语言、Python、C++等。了解这些编程语言的语法和特性,能够编写出与硬件设备交互的程序。

    除了以上技术,还需要具备一定的问题解决能力和创造力。零件编程往往需要面对各种挑战和难题,需要能够分析问题、找到解决方案,并能够创造性地应用技术来实现自己的创意。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要进行零件编程,需要掌握以下几项技术:

    1. 编程语言:零件编程通常使用的是高级编程语言,如C++、Python等。掌握至少一种编程语言是必要的,因为它们提供了丰富的库和函数,方便进行零件编程。

    2. CAD软件:CAD(计算机辅助设计)软件是进行零件编程的基础工具。掌握至少一种CAD软件,如SolidWorks、AutoCAD等,可以帮助你进行零件的建模和设计。

    3. 数值计算:在零件编程中,常常需要进行数值计算,比如计算零件的尺寸、重量、力学性能等。掌握数值计算的方法和工具,如数学公式、计算机辅助工具(如MATLAB、Excel等),可以帮助你进行准确的计算。

    4. 数据结构和算法:在零件编程中,常常需要处理大量的数据,因此掌握数据结构和算法是必要的。了解常用的数据结构,如数组、链表、栈、队列等,并熟悉常见的算法,如排序、查找等,可以提高编程效率和质量。

    5. 机器人编程:如果你需要进行机器人零件编程,那么掌握机器人编程技术是必不可少的。了解机器人的运动学和动力学原理,熟悉机器人编程语言,如ROS(机器人操作系统),可以帮助你实现机器人零件的控制和运动。

    6. 物理模拟:在进行零件编程时,有时需要进行物理模拟,以模拟零件的行为和性能。掌握物理模拟的方法和工具,如有限元分析软件、多体动力学仿真软件等,可以帮助你进行准确的物理模拟。

    7. 测试和调试:在进行零件编程时,测试和调试是必不可少的步骤。掌握测试和调试的方法和工具,如单元测试、集成测试、调试器等,可以帮助你及时发现和修复错误,提高程序的稳定性和可靠性。

    总之,要进行零件编程,需要掌握编程语言、CAD软件、数值计算、数据结构和算法、机器人编程、物理模拟、测试和调试等多项技术。不同的零件编程任务可能需要不同的技术,因此根据具体的需求选择相应的技术进行学习和应用。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部